Player: Tyree Harris
Height: 6'3"
Weight: 185 pounds
Coming in at number 17 in our player countdown is sophomore wide receiver Tyree Harris. Harris was a consensus 3-star prospect in the 2013 recruiting class. He was Wake's highest rated recruit according to 247's composite ratings and chose Wake Forest over Mississippi State.
Tyree did not play in Wake's first four games last season, but former head coach Jim Grobe decided to burn his redshirt against Army. Harris ultimately played in eight games season, including six starts. He is a candidate to have a breakout year in 2014 due to how he finished last season. In Harris' last four games he caught 15 passes for 160 yards. His most notable performance was his game against Miami in which he caught 6 passes for 96 yards. Harris had a strong spring game that included a 44-yard reception.
Tyree suffered a minor ankle injury last week during practice, but he will compete still with Matt James and Jared Crump for the X & S receiver positions. Either way, all three should get significant playing time.
